Great Western Auctions offers an in-house postage & packaging service for appropriate items. Each request is assessed on an individual basis to determine the best method of dispatch and relevant costs. You can request a postage quote once you receive your invoice from Easylive. Our postage team will send you an updated invoice which can be paid via bank transfer. Once the lot(s) and postage fees are settled in full, we aim to dispatch items within 10 working days. This timeframe is not guaranteed. You will be provided a tracking code once available.

 

While items that are due to be shipped will be handled with care and packaged to the best of our ability, we do not claim to be professional packers or shippers. Great Western Auctions will not be held responsible for any claim in the event of loss or damage. We may be able to make claims via the couriers we use (Royal Mail & Parcelforce) but this is not guaranteed.

 

If you have a query regarding any stage of delivery or status of your item, please use the messaging function through the link provided in delivery email you have been sent.

 

If you would like a pre-sales quote, please submit this via the request a condition report option on the lot page.

 

Items deemed too fragile and at risk of breakage will be rejected for postage and alternative services will be recommended in the interests of the client. Couriers will also be able to insure items that we are unable to insure.

 

We use Royal Mail Special Delivery (insured up to £2,500 hammer price) for smaller items under 2kg.

 

Larger and heavier items are sent with Parcelforce 48H within the UK. Parcelforce offer free compensation for items sent via this service up to a value of £100. Any item exceeding this value that is sent via this service is not insured. Enhanced compensation is available for certain Parcelforce services – buyers should familiarise themselves with Parcelforce’s compensation cover restrictions to ensure their item falls within this service.

 

A packing only service is also available. Once an item has been packed, we will provide dimensions and weight of the package(s) to the buyer so they can book a collection with their chosen courier.

 

Import duty, Export of Goods & Customs Tax

 

Items sent to the EU and overseas may be subject to import fees imposed by the country of receipt. Potential buyers must be aware of any additional fees they may incur when importing items.

 

Any customs declarations filled out by Great Western Auctions will detail the hammer price of the item(s). This will not be amended.

 

Great Western Auctions reserve the right to refuse postage of items overseas if we deem them unfit. We will not pay out for any claim against parcels sent overseas.

 

Several countries prohibit the import of goods containing materials from endangered species such as tortoiseshell & rhino horn. Buyers who are interested in lots containing these materials must be aware of any customs regulations relating to the import and export of said materials prior to placing a bid. Great Western Auctions will not assist the buyer in matters regarding the import or export of these materials.

 

 

Prohibited Items

Some items/components in items that we sell cannot be posted.

  • Lighters and refills containing flammable liquid or gas
  • Perfumes and aftershaves – not sealed
  • Alcoholic beverages containing more than 70% alcohol by volume
  • Certain batteries
  • Grenades, shells, mortars and ammunition
